Urban Ecosystem-based Adoption for Climate Resilience (UEbA) is an essential component of the Kathmandu Valley Development Authority (KVDA) initiative. UEbA has established a robust Grievance Redress Mechanism (GRM) to facilitate the reception and resolution of complaints arising from UEbA activities. This mechanism allows any party affected by these activities to submit a complaint, and even permits representatives to file complaints on behalf of affected parties, provided that the representative can demonstrate the requisite authority.

The primary objective of the GRM is to ensure the timely and effective resolution of complaints, fostering improved mutual understanding between the involved parties. Oversight of the Grievance Redress Mechanism process is undertaken by a dedicated team within the Kathmandu Valley Development Authority, reinforcing its commitment to enhancing accountability, transparency, and community engagement in the pursuit of climate resilience through UEbA in Kathmandu Valley.
